Output 8407e3de1143f34fabe18ef347334da594f8bfa9776938a2985ba20c17419584:11

value
14700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54b332577bc3d2c22688dc986a78c15593076c4a OP_EQUAL
address
MFd1fLynAtAJYxHo9gPitgh5Q6WZEYP3MG
transaction
8407e3de1143f34fabe18ef347334da594f8bfa9776938a2985ba20c17419584
spent
true